Obtain from your library or your instructor a copy of the following article: Thomas L. Barton and John B. MacArthur, "The New Hue of Green for the Management Accountant," Strategic Finance (March 2011), pp. 36-41. The article provides a model for evaluating investments in energy-saving technologies that are both cost-effective and environmentally friendly. The authors use an actual example (Jiminy Peak Mountain Resort, www.jiminypeak.com) to illustrate the role that management accountants can play in the evaluation of sustainability-related investment proposals.
